Sleep

What to anticipate from Vue.js in 2024

.Similar to the remainder of the main end growth planet, the Vue planet scoots. Within this post, I would love to check out at the present state of Vue and share my forecasts on where points could be moved in 2024.Vue 2 End of Lifestyle.As the Vue.js community continues to develop, 2024 spots a notable shift along with completion of lifestyle for Vue 2. This shift signals an action towards advanced models, emphasizing the need for designers to improve their abilities and uses.Using this milestone, anticipate the composition API, Pinia, composables, as well as TypeScript to become utilized highly within Vue applications this year. You can obtain your team up to time on these modern technologies with our thorough collection of video programs.Vue Water Vapor Setting.One of the best stimulating advancements in the Vue community is actually the overview of 'Vapor Mode.' Evan first revealed Water vapor mode by the end of 2022 within this blog. While desires of a 2023 launch definitely may not be feasible currently, the outlook for a launch in 2024 appears great.For those unfamiliar with Water vapor mode, this innovation targets to eliminate the digital DOM for efficiency gains while keeping the existing text configuration phrase structure with the arrangement API. The attribute will certainly be actually opt-in at the element or even app degree. For a deeper dive into Water vapor Setting's functionalities as well as ramifications, check out this thorough write-up.Vue Certificate.In 2023, Vue University, in collaboration along with the Vue core crew, released the main Vue.js qualification program. This year 2000 devs and also firms worldwide have actually presently acquired the cert. 157 designers have passed the exam as well as are officially approved. A lot more are signed up to take the exam, while others are examining around toenail a 2nd attempt.In 2024, our experts count on the system to remain to increase in appeal as the examination gives a counted on method for creators to confirm their abilities to prospective companies while business may simplify the hiring process as well as be a lot more self-assured in their brand new hires.If you aren't among the 157 yet accredited as well as are on the task search, you need to seriously take into consideration taking the test as a technique to finesse the competition.Efficiency Improvements.A significant emphasis for front-end structures has actually traditionally performed functionality. 2024 will definitely be no different.Evan lately announced growth on a port of rollup for Rust named Rolldown. It concentrates on functionality with best-effort being compatible along with Rollup and is slated to hasten the already very prompt Vue construct resource of choice: Vite.Observing the trend of enhancements like those seen within this pull demand, Vue.js is actually additionally anticipated to continue progressing in terms of velocity and also performance in the core public library. One such function is lazy hydration baked in as a possibility to defineAsyncComponent.New and also Solidified Characteristics.Vue.js possesses a range of new as well as existing experimental functions that are actually very likely to land as dependable add-ons to the framework in 2024. None of the adhering to are a sure thing, however my bet is you'll see at least a large number of them by the end of the year:.v-model on and also.: Enhancements such as this pull request are actually making it easier to tie data and also improve user interface.A secure defineModel: The introduction of a stable defineModel, as discussed in this post offers some nice syntactic glucose to take care of a slightly lengthy usual usage instance. Aim to see this loosened the speculative tag in 2024.A secure Suspense Component: this component has actually put on the experimental tag for pretty some time today. Substantial usage within the popular Nuxt 3 meta-framework ought to guarantee quite little changes continuing, so I expect this getting to a secure stage very soon.Relative Props: The prospective intro of relative props, as suggested in this issue, can provide additional expressive and pliable TypeScript help for components.Vue Hub Data Loaders: The dialogue encompassing Vue router data loaders, as seen in this particular RFC, signifies an initiative to improve data fetching and also routing in Vue treatments.Nuxt.Nuxt 3 has run out beta for a year right now as well as it is actually pay attention to the complete pile has created it a go-to tool for many Vue.js creators. It is actually been discharging brand-new components this year at a break-neck pace consisting of:.